Description:
Image depicts memorial gravemarker for the camel driver Greek George. Marker reads: "Greek George, born in Smyrna as George
Caralambo came to this country as a camel driver for the United States Government in 1857. Naturalized--George Allen in 1867.
Died Spet. 2, 1913 at Old Mission. Historical marker erected by Whittier Parlor No. 298 Native Daughters of the Golden West,
Courtesy of F. G. Simmons and R.D. White June 30,1956."
